Abstract

In this paper, a general reliability-updating formula is proposed for trellis-based soft-output decoding algorithms to optimize the tradeoff between performance and complexity. Based on the general formula, new algorithms are presented, and a concise interpretation is provided to relate new proposed algorithms and those reported previously. In addition, we devise a unified decoding structure with respect to the general formula. All trellis-based algorithms are mapped into a single decoding process under the unified structure, and different algorithms can be easily switched between one another. Owing to the modularity and flexibility, this unified structure is especially suitable for turbo decoders with programmable implementation.
